Consumer:Ask your doctor before using rifAMPin together with imatinib. RifAMPin may decrease the effects of imatinib. Contact your doctor if your condition worsens. If your doctor prescribes these medications together, you may need a dose adjustment to safely use both medications. It is important to tell your doctor about all other medications you use, including vitamins and herbs. Do not stop using any medications without first talking to your doctor.
Professional:GENERALLY AVOID: Coadministration with rifampin may significantly decrease the plasma concentrations of imatinib. The mechanism is rifampin induction of CYP450 3A4, the isoenzyme responsible for the metabolic clearance of imatinib. In 14 healthy volunteers, pretreatment with rifampin (600 mg orally once daily for 10 days) decreased the mean peak plasma concentration (Cmax) and area under the concentration-time curve (AUC) of imatinib (400 mg single oral dose) by 54% and 74%, respectively, compared to administration of imatinib alone. The clearance was increased 385% during rifampin coadministration. Although the pharmacokinetics of imatinib were subject to a high degree of intersubject variation, the interaction was reported in every subject.
MANAGEMENT: Due to the magnitude of the interaction that can potentially result in subtherapeutic plasma concentrations of imatinib, concomitant use with rifampin should be avoided if possible.
